Output e8d3c9169488877d18fa9fb5cf03217d3fc7c479bf847004f2308a883a2c3e8c:13

value
101815
script pubkey
OP_0 OP_PUSHBYTES_20 53b0ae92c5d04ed7cb1134153e7355f88408865f
address
bc1q2wc2ayk96p8d0jc3xs2nuu64lzzq3pjl4cqwe2
transaction
e8d3c9169488877d18fa9fb5cf03217d3fc7c479bf847004f2308a883a2c3e8c
confirmations
69351
spent
true